You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Herzing University - Kenner. The school came in at #1 for the Most Veteran Friendly in Louisiana for Interior Design Management for a Master’s. Kenner, Louisiana is the setting for this small institution of higher learning. The private not-for-profit school handed out masters’s interior design management degrees to 7 students in 2020-2021.
Herzing University - Kenner also took the #1 spot in our “Best Interior Design Management Master’s Degree Schools in Louisiana” ranking.According to our most recent data, Herzing University - Kenner supports 462 students, and 22 of those are GI Bill® students, of which 18 are Post-9/11 GI Bill® recipients. The average tuition and fees award for the Post-9/11 GI Bill® recipients was $11,202. To help with additional expenses, 0 students received funds through the Yellow Ribbon Program. Eligible students may be able to receive credit for their military training.
